UNICAJA tabs point guard Blakney
Unicaja has reached an agreement with playmaker Roderick Blakney on a two-month deal, the Spanish powerhouse announced Thursday. Blakney (181, 34) arrives from Panellinios, where he averaged 11.1 points on 52.9% three-pointers, 3.1 assists and 1.6 steals in 16 Eurocup games last season. He helped Panellinios go all the way from the Qualifying Rounds to the Eurocup Finals and led the competition in three-point accuracy, hitting 27 of 51 shots from downtown. Blakney has also played for Turk Telekom in Turkey; Olympiacos, Maroussi, AEK and Iraklis in Greece; Dynamo Moscow Region in Russia; Los Prados and CPD Club in the Dominican Republic, Cincinnati in the IBL, Dakota in the IBA and Sioux Fall in the CBA during his lengthy career. He won the Turkish President's Cup with Turk Telekom in 2009 and made it to the Greek League finals with AEK in 2003, Marousi in 2004 and Olympiacos in 2008. Blakney steps in to replace Terrell McIntyre, who will be sidelined for at least three more weeks due to a foot injury.
